Transaction 3dfe127eaa43e65895f7631bd8284ad86d04800a9984e38146c85b918a50566a

1 Input
1 Outputs
  • 3dfe127eaa43e65895f7631bd8284ad86d04800a9984e38146c85b918a50566a:0
  • value  196500
    address  15WXTGyxKF8spWas34t3xDYcJcDbv2P6FP